  • Patent number: 7054795
    Abstract: A method for optimizing the segment lengths of a segmented transmission line, comprising the steps of modeling the electrical performance of the segmented transmission line, and evaluating the model for incremental changes in electrical performance, selecting a set of segment lengths which meets a set of predefined optimization criteria. The predefined optimization criteria is, for example, minimum peak VSWR.

  • Patent number: 6052044
    Abstract: A waveguide for high power radio frequency transmission, comprising a tubular member having an ellipsoidal cross section and relatively uniform wall thickness having a ratio of major to minor axes between about 1.5 to 2.0 and a minimum minor axis of about 20 cm.

  • Patent number: 5959506
    Abstract: A coaxial waveguide corner structure, having a pair of incoming inner conductors, each inner conductor having an axis and an end, the pair of inner conductors having non-coincident axes, and a conductive bridging element having two ends within an enclosure. Each end of the conductive bridging element is adapted to provide a continuous conductive surface between the outer edge of the pair of inner conductors, adapted to provide a low loss and low reflection radio frequency electromagnetic wave path between said pair of inner conductors. The conductive bridging element thus has a section profile matching a section profile of the adjoining inner conductor, at the respective bevel angles. The conductive bridging element preferably has a cross section shape different than a cross section shape of the conductors, preferably elliptical.

  • Patent number: 5880648
    Abstract: A high power Gysel multinode power network for an RF signal, having a plurality of RF ports, a plurality of RF isolation loads, each load being connected through a coaxial transmission line to a respective RF port, a combined port, comprising a first hub having a plurality of first radiating arms, each radiating arm comprising a coaxial transmission line extending to one of said RF ports, a node, comprising a second hub having a plurality of second radiating arms, each radiating arm comprising a coaxial transmission line extending to one of said RF isolation loads; and a common heat sink for dissipating heat from said plurality of RF isolation loads.
